Crime Grade's assault map shows the safest places in Roseland in green. The most dangerous areas in Roseland are in red, with moderately safe areas in yellow. Crime rates on the map are weighted by the type and severity of the crime.
The D grade means the rate of assault is higher than the average US city. Roseland is in the 18th percentile for safety, meaning 82% of cities are safer and 18%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to Roseland's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ities.
The rate of assault in Roseland is 3.584 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in Roseland generally consider the northwest part of the city to be the safest.
Your chance of being a victim of assault in Roseland may be as high as 1 in 252 in the northeast ne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 290 in the northwest part of the city.

The chart below compares the assault rate in Roseland to the Kansas state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.
| Roseland, KS: | 3.584 |
|---|---|
| Kansas: | 3.205 |
| USA: | 2.561 |
Considering only the assault rate, Roseland is less safe than the Kansas state average and less safe than the national average.
